CelebratEArts 2023: Aging Unbound
About the Exhibition:
CelebratEArts is an annual arts festival celebrating the creative works of Older New Yorkers who bring color, creativity, and compassion to our community through their varied artistic endeavors. This year’s festival theme—Aging Unbound—offers us an opportunity to explore diverse aging experiences and to recognize how we all benefit when older adults remain engaged, independent, and included. All month long we are proud to showcase art from older adult members of the Weinberg Center for Balanced Living, Sirovich Center for Balanced Living, Co-Op Village NORC, Project ORE, and 14th Street Y.
This virtual gallery exhibits the work of our Creative Arts Therapy classes. Creative Arts Therapy is a mental health field that explores art as a means of healing and making connections as well as maintaining a holistic approach to wellness. Led by graduate interns from Pratt Institute (Candice Chung, Ai Hayatsu, Vivien Huang, and Rachel Woelfel), classes use art as a therapeutic tool that emphasizes process over product. Through art-making, members reflect, build confidence, connect, express, and develop a stronger sense of community.

In addition, independent submissions from members of our virtual and hybrid arts programs are featured. Through remote learning, Educational Alliance has helped homebound New Yorkers, as well as those relocating from their neighborhoods as a result of the COVID-19 pandemic, remain engaged with their peers and connected to the communities they still call home.
